Apache Dream is a white (non-hispanic) neighborhood in Apache Junction with 1 census tract and a population of 4,076 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 3.6/10 (Lower t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 66%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 26%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$951/month sits 17% lower than the Apache Junction citywide average ($1,146).

Is Apache Dream a high social-vulnerability area?

Apache Dream sits in the 84th percentile nationally on the CDC Social Vulnerability Index (highly vulnerable). The index combines poverty, unemployment, household composition, racial/ethnic minority share, and housing/transportation factors across all US census tracts.
